Rehabilitation of Existing Sewers in Southern Catchment Area of Colombo Municipal Council
The Government of Sri Lanka, with funding support from the European Investment Bank (EIB), is implementing a strategic urban infrastructure project to rehabilitate and modernize the existing sewer network across key locations in Colombo, including Maligawatta, Borella, Colombo Fort, Slave Island, and parts of Colombo South. This high-priority initiative is designed to address the city’s growing wastewater management challenges by upgrading critical pipelines, enhancing pumping station capacity, and improving treatment facilities to meet present and future demands. The project scope covers comprehensive civil works, mechanical and electrical system upgrades, replacement of deteriorated pipelines, and the installation of advanced monitoring and control systems. By targeting densely populated and commercially significant areas, the works will drastically reduce blockages, infiltration, and overflows, while enhancing the network’s resilience against climate impacts such as urban flooding.
Through modern engineering solutions and sustainable practices, the rehabilitation programme will significantly improve wastewater collection and treatment efficiency, protect marine and inland water bodies from contamination, and contribute to Colombo’s long-term urban resilience and public health objectives.
